Tewkesbury Borough Council is facing significant service disruptions after a recent cyber attack. As a result, many council services are currently unavailable, and the council is advising residents to only reach out if it’s absolutely necessary.

The council took immediate action on Wednesday afternoon by shutting down its systems to manage the situation. This was part of their planned response to protect against further damage. An investigation is ongoing, and the council is working closely with national cybersecurity experts and fraud prevention agencies to resolve the issue.

“We expect delays with many of our services, and our phone lines are likely to be extremely busy,” a council spokesperson said.

Residents and local businesses are encouraged to be patient during this time, as the council works to restore services as quickly as possible.
